Safety

Wall mounted electric fireplaces are a great option for those who wish to create a warm and modern look to their condo, home, apartment, or office without taking up a lot of space. They come in a variety of sizes and styles that will accommodate any room, big or small. They can also be customized with different finishes and colors. Many offer a bed of glowing flames and embers to create a peaceful atmosphere in any room.

They can provide warmth and style in any room. However they must be set up properly to ensure safety and maximum performance. To reduce the risk of fire, all materials that could ignite should be kept at a distance of 3 feet or more away from the unit. The vents through which hot air is blown out should be kept open and not blocked. This will allow the hot air to move more efficiently throughout the room, resulting in an efficient heating.

Most wall mounted electric fireplaces come with instructions which explain how to install them in your office or at home. Many instructions include pictures or videos of the actual installation, so that people can follow them. Some might require the assistance of a professional electrician in order to install in a commercial or residential building, but most are fairly simple and quick to install.

The most important consideration is to select a model that is CSA-certified and features an automatic shut-off function in the event of a short circuit or overheating. The majority of models also have thermostats that control the temperature level, meaning you can select the temperature you prefer in your office or home.

It is also essential to shut off the fireplace when you leave the house or go to bed. Not only will you save on energy usage, but you will also prevent electrical problems as well as fire hazards. Verify that the cord isn't in contact with anything, or that it does not touch anything that could ignite in the event of an overheated circuit.

Convenience

Electric fireplace wall mounted are a great choice for those who want an attractive, practical accent to their living space but don't have enough space to install an traditional wood or gas fireplace. They're easy to install and typically come with the brackets you require to hang them like a picture or TV. Ventless, they don't produce smoke or a chimney. You can also control the flames using a remote.

Most of these fireplaces will come with a mantel and various design options, meaning you can mix them with your style. For instance, you could choose a wood finish to complement a rustic or country-style and black metal fireplaces go well with contemporary and modern designs. Some models are able to be built into the wall to create a unique look, while others are freestanding and can be put anywhere in your home.

You should also think about the amount of the heat that your fireplace can generate. There are models that offer only an enveloping glow or with up to 1500W of heating power. The first is more energy efficient and will save you money on electricity, while the second is ideal for zone heating or additional heating.

In addition to the flames and ember bed, some models also come with a backlight that can be switched from white to red, or dim. This creates a dramatic and romantic atmosphere, which is particularly beneficial in smaller rooms.

Some models will even have built-in thermostats that let you set your desired temperature. The fireplace will automatically adjust its temperature to meet the setting. You can also use the heating function without the flames, if you prefer to relax in the warm ambience.

Although it is possible to install a wall-mounted or recessed electric fireplace by yourself but it's usually recommended to employ an expert to ensure that the installation is done correctly and safely. It may be necessary, depending on the size of your chosen model, to construct the framework or box to support the fireplace. Make sure it is securely anchored against the wall. It's also a good idea to measure the intended installation area before purchasing the unit, so you do not end with a fireplace that's too big or too small for the space you have.

Installation

Depending on the model that you choose, some electric fires are made to be semi-permanent and will need to be attached to a wall with either a wall bracket or hanging screws. Review the installation instructions that come with your fireplace to get the right direction. If you are not confident in drilling into a wall, you might consider hiring an electrician to complete the work.

First, you'll need choose the location to install the fireplace on your wall. It is essential to decide this before you begin as it will help you ensure that the electric fire is placed in a secure location and will fit properly into your chosen room. You'll also require an outlet for power close by. It is important to have enough space for you to connect the fireplace without using an extension cable. But it shouldn't be close to any flammable items like curtains or furniture.

Once you've found the perfect spot for the electric fire, you'll have to prepare the wall to allow for the installation. If you're installing it in a wall, you'll have to cut two 2x6s an inch shorter than the final wall's height. Mark the centre point on each plate as well as the stud locations using pencil. Then drill holes for the mounting bracket and ensure that they're placed according to the specifications for the fireplace you're using.

Certain models of wall-mounted electric fires have a template to show the locations where holes must be dug. Mark the wall with a spirit-level and pencil. Next, you can use the rawl plugs that came with your fire to install them into the holes in the wall.

When the wall-mounted fireplace is secured, you can hang its front glass. Then, just connect it to the wall and enjoy! You can even include a remote control if you'd like to make it more convenient. Wall-mounted electric fireplaces are a great way to add warmth and style to any space.
